6 Real Estate Professionals Every Los Angeles Landlord Need

March 1, 2018

property managers

As a Los Angeles landlord, you cannot do everything alone. While you may have some skills that will allow you do some tasks yourself and save money, there are some real estate professionals that you cannot do without.

These professionals will help you manage your property. As the owner of the property, you still need someone that will help you take care of your legal problems, you need someone to ensure that your property is in top-notch condition and another professional to ensure you have  clients that will fill your vacant apartment.

Of course, all these are not what one person can handle. Whether you are trying to save money or not, you cannot do without certain real estate professionals. In fact, the Los Angeles fair housing policy requires that you work with some of these professionals we will mention below.

Top 6 Real Estate Professionals You Cannot Do Without

  1. Real Estate Lawyer

You need to stay complaint to Los Angeles fair housing policy and to do this; you will need to be working with attorneys that are experienced in Los Angeles housing laws. Moreover, staying complaint isn’t the only reason you need a real estate attorney, there are some times you may run into some legal issues. You need to be working with an attorney that can always come to your aid anytime you found yourself in legal troubles.

  1. Certified Public Accountant

Even if you are very meticulous with management, you cannot always keep up with all the paperwork especially when you are managing multiple properties. As a Los Angeles landlord, you should be working with an experienced accountant who will help you take care of your paperwork as well as your taxes.

Don’t just look for an accountant when you are in trouble, start working with one already. An accountant that knows your situation will be in the best position to help you when you are in trouble.

  1. General Contractor

You cannot escape from making repairs. When you have a rental property, there will be time emergency repairs will come up. When this happen, you need to have the phone number of an experienced general contractor on a speed dial.

Usually, emergency repairs are time sensitive and will require immediate attention. When they happen, you shouldn’t be looking for a new contractor, instead, you should be calling the one you already have a relationship with.

  1. Property Inspector

Move-ins and move-outs can be tricky. When a tenant moves out, you may need the service of a property inspector to ensure that your property is still up to standard and you are not violating any code before another tenant moves in.

You may not always need a property inspector. However, when you are managing multiple properties, it is recommended that you stay on a safe side by working with a property inspector.

  1. Property Manager

You need an experienced Los Angeles property manager as a landlord. A property manager will help you with marketing. He will help you bring new tenants to avoid long vacancy period. Whether you live close to your property or not; it can benefit from the service of a property manager. Just make sure you choose an experience Los Angeles property manager in order to make sure your property is in good hands.

 Conclusion

As a Los Angeles landlord, you need these real estate professionals mentioned above. Working with these professional will ensure that you business moves seamlessly and you can easily take it to the next level.
